About this experience

This is a private lesson for just you and your friends. It’s for all ages and abilities. Please arrive at our base five minutes before the scheduled lesson start time (we can pick you up from your hotel for a small charge). We’ll talk you through using the board, keeping safe on the river and the basic SUP technique. We’ll show you how to get on and off the board and how to paddle, all on dry land. We’ll then get you onto the river with our instructor and you’ll be standing before you know it. When the lesson and is over, we’ll return you to the base. About Kanchanaburi

Kanchanaburi is known for its stunning natural beauty, rich history, and the infamous Death Railway. It offers a mix of historical sites, waterfalls, and national parks, making it a perfect destination for nature lovers and history buffs alike.
